Customer Service Manager Jobs in Honolulu, HI

A Customer Service Manager oversees the customer service team and all customer service activities, ensuring that the team provides the highest level of customer satisfaction. Their responsibilities include developing customer service policies, managing and hiring team members, handling complaints, and analyzing customer service data to improve business operations. They interact directly with customers to address inquiries, resolve issues, or to provide assistance with products or services. They are also responsible for providing training and development for their team, and often collaborate with other departments to integrate customer service objectives throughout the organization.

Important skills for a Customer Service Manager include excellent communication and leadership abilities, problem-solving skills, the ability to handle stressful situations, and strong knowledge of customer service software and databases. Certifications in Customer Service Management, Leadership, or related fields are advantageous. A Bachelor's degree in Business Administration or related field is often required. Some roles a person might hold before becoming a Customer Service Manager include Customer Service Representative, Customer Service Team Leader, or Customer Support Specialist.
